    Lightbulb PINCHED wire - how to fix???

    Quote Originally Posted by Digitalwoodshop View Post
    I pulled the cable for the board sensor down trying to get a better angle to plug it in... I pulled the wire down along the track and it PINCHED the wires as seen in the last picture. When the wires got pinched, they shorted... I got a Open cover all the time and no board sensor or rubber rollers as in my case I took out the 5 volts.

    I think I did this exact same thing.

    What did you do to fix this??

    Quote Originally Posted by Dolan View Post
    I think I did this exact same thing.

    What did you do to fix this??
    I took the Y Truck off... Even snapped a screw as seen in the pictures.... But I wondered if I could do then butt Floss Trick... un hook the board sensor. Un hook the top plug. TUG the wire UP to dislodge the pinch. Then pull down and up, seeing if you feel it free.... Worth a try....
